RPI GTC or any exhaust without drone

This may sound crazy, but is anyone local within the tri state area who has a full exhaust system and I can listen to it in person? I have the RPI GTA cat back exhaust on my car and im growing tired of the drone, but thinking about going with a full system... I was thinking the GTC, I heard its a lot less drone and a lot quieter then the GTM, but read on this forum that some stated it still has some minor drone. Im looking for options and suggestions... And I would love to hear some in person if possible, i find that the video clips aren't always true to the actual sound... Thanks :-) Mel
